Abstract

The ellipse projected from a circle or a sphere in 3D can be used to recover the position of the circle or the sphere, if the model radius is known. A closed-form solution for the 3D position and orientation of a circular feature and the 3D position of a spherical feature is described. There are two general solutions for the circular feature, but there is only one solution when the surface normal of the circular feature passes through the center of projection. This method handles spherical as well as circular features. It has closed-form solutions, and it gives only the necessary number of solutions (no redundant solutions)
